Paul Sherry is an award-winning Irish guitarist, singer, and songwriter whose work bridges old-school rock authenticity with modern depth and intention. A recognised force on the Irish rock ’n’ roll scene since the age of sixteen, Sherry combines rich guitar technicality, rugged vocal delivery, and thoughtful songwriting to carve a powerful sound.

Best known as lead guitarist with the award-winning Gráinne Duffy Band, Sherry is also a full-time touring solo artist, session musician, and educator. His career is marked by high-calibre collaborations with an impressive list of international artists, including Marc Ford (The Black Crowes), Dale Davis (Amy Winehouse), Arron Sterling (John Mayer, Post Malone), Jorgen Carlsson (Gov’t Mule), Kenny Aronoff (Smashing Pumpkins) and Justin Stanley (Beck) - a testament to his versatility and respected presence in the industry.

Sherry’s latest album, Peace In Mind, is a rock and roots journey that balances introspection with fire. The record recently earned a glowing 4 stars from RnR Magazine, alongside back-to-back No.1 singles on the UK’s Future Hits Top 40 Radio, further cementing his reputation as a compelling recording artist.

Renowned for his minimalist yet powerful guitar setup and tone-first philosophy, Sherry draws inspiration from blues legends and classic rock heroes while maintaining a sound that is distinctly his own, focused on feel, dynamics, and expression. His live performances reflect this ethos: raw, energetic, and deeply engaging.

His work has received widespread acclaim from Hot Press, RnR Magazine, RTÉ Lyric FM, Belfast Telegraph, Front View Magazine, Grateful Web, Dublin City FM, Real Rock UK and more.
